Mattern, a Registered Professional Engineer in the State of <br />Colorado, in accordance with 2CCR407-2, Section 4.05.6(7), do certify that <br />Johnson Gulch dams 7A, 9, and 10 were constructed under my direct supervision. <br />Dams 7A and 9 were constructed in early 1985 (February-April) and enlarged <br />during pond cleaning operations in July. Dam 10 was constructed during the <br />summer of 1985 (August-September). Dams 7A and 9 were surveyed for capacity <br />determination in January, 1986. Dam 10 was surveyed in September, 1985. <br />Stage storage relationships, spillway elevations and hydrographs for a <br />10-year, 24-hour event and a 25-year, 24-hour event are shown in the attached <br />SEDIMOT II output. <br />During construction the dams were visually inspected daily to insure compli- <br />ance with prudent state-of-the-art construction meth ode. Compaction was <br />accomplished by laying fill in thin horizontal layers and compacting with a <br />vibratory roller compactor and dozers and/or scrapers. Standard Proctor den- <br />sities were determined in our lab using methods outlined in AASHO T99-61. <br />Percent compaction was monitored using a nuclear density probe until densities <br />were sufficiently high to insure stability. <br /> <br />~..
